This study aimed to identify the research gaps in Metaheuristics, taking into account the publications entered in a database in 2015 and to present a case study of a company in the Sul Fluminense region using the Desirability function. To achieve this goal, applied research of exploratory nature and qualitative approach was carried out, as well as another of quantitative nature. As method and technical procedures were the bibliographical research, some literature review, and an adopted case study respectively. As a contribution of this research, the holistic view of opportunities to carry out new investigations on the theme in question is pointed out. It is noteworthy that the identified study gaps after the research were prioritized and discriminated, highlighting the importance of the viability of metaheuristic algorithms, as well as their benefits for process optimization.
With growing competition for markets in the various production sectors, both in Brazil are looking for improvements in the world, as well as improvements that can improve their productivity and reduce production costs and quality services. For this, among other strategic actions, continuous improvement can be sought as a means to remain competitive. In this context, the present work case, developed as a work study, has as its central objective the reduction of refuges generated by deficiencies in the production process in a metallurgical company that manufactures ductile iron pipes, among other products. From the application of the method and quality tools used, it was possible to identify the main causes of scrap, favoring its reduction through process improvements. With the identification and analysis of problems related to the training of manpower, lack of compliance with material specifications, inadequate or unfulfilled methods of production and making adjustments to machines used in production processes, it was possible to reduce the occurrence of defects in cast iron pipes, when compared to the amount of scrap counted before and after the changes implemented. The results achieved showed significant gains for the company by reducing the amount of scrap and rework generated during the production process. The reduction in the occurrence of defects favored a reduction of costs, contributing for the company to become more competitive.
